Names
ECHINOPS giganteus A. Rich. [family COMPOSITAE], Tent. Fl. Abyss. 1: 449 (1848); Oliv. & Hiern in F.T.A. 3: 432 (1877); F.P.S. 3: 25 (1956); C.D. Adams in F.W.T.A. ed. 2, 2: 291 (1963); C. Jeffrey in K.B. 22: 117 (1968); Maquet in Fl. Rwanda 3: 672 (1985); Mesfin & Berhanu in Mitt. Inst. Bot. Hamburg 23b: 615 (1990); Lisowski, Aster. Fl. Afr. Centr. 2: 578, fig. 119 (1991); Mesfin in K.B. 52: 888 (1997). Type: Ethiopia, Semien, Kouaieta, Quartin-Dillon & Petit 628 (P!, holo.)
ECHINOPS velutinus O. Hoffm. [family COMPOSITAE], in E.J. 30: 440 (1901). Type: Tanzania, Mbeya/Chunya District, Usafwa, Goetze 1035 (B†, holo., K!, iso.)
ECHINOPS brevisetus S. Moore [family COMPOSITAE], in J.L.S. 37: 174 (1905); Mattf. in E.J. 59, Beibl. 133: 60 (1924). Type: Uganda, Ankole District, Burumba, Bagshawe 377 (BM!, holo.)
ECHINOPS seretii De Wild. [family COMPOSITAE], in Ann. Mus. Congo, Bot., ser. 2: 214, t. 62 (1907), as sereti; Mattf. in E.J. 59, Beibl. 133: 61 (1924). Type: Congo (Kinshasa), NE area, Seret (BR!, holo.)
ECHINOPS negrii Chiov. [family COMPOSITAE], in Ann. Bot. Roma 9: 77 (1911). Type: Ethiopia, Tzellemti, Chiovenda 3185 (FT!, holo.)
ECHINOPS bequaertii De Wild. [family COMPOSITAE], in Rev. Zool. Afr. 8, Suppl. Bot.: 3 (1920). Type: Congo (Kinshasa), Irumu, Beqaert 2727 (BR!, holo.)
ECHINOPS seretii Mattf. var. setifer [family COMPOSITAE], in E.J. 59, Beibl. 133: 63 (1924). Type: Tanzania, Bukoba District, Karagwe, Ruanjan Mts, Stuhlmann 1989 (B†, holo.)
ECHINOPS francinianus Pic. Serm. [family COMPOSITAE], Miss. Stud. Lago Tana 7, Ricc. Bot. 1: 165, t. 34 (1951). Type: Ethiopia, Gojjam/Gonder, Bahir Dar, Pichi Sermolli 2175 (FT!, holo.)
ECHINOPS nistrii Pic. Serm. [family COMPOSITAE], Miss. Stud. Lago Tana 7, Ricc. Bot. 1: 167, t. 35 (1951). Type: Ethiopia, Gonder, Zeghie, Pichi Sermolli 2174 (FT!, holo.)
ECHINOPS kulsii Cufod. [family COMPOSITAE], in Senck. Biol. 47: 260, t. 8 (1966). Type: Ethiopia, Sidamo, Bera, Kuls 86 (FR!, holo.)
Information
Shrubby herb 0.5–1.8 (?–4) m high; stems ribbed, hardly branched or branched, white-tomentose to yellow-brown velvety. Leaves spiny, pinnatifid to bipinnatisect with 3–6 pairs of lobes, 2–60(–90) cm long, 1–25 cm wide, the basal leaves largest, base semi-amplexicaul, margins spiny, apices spiny, pale green above with arachnoid tomentum but glabrescent, often glandular, whitish tomentose beneath. Capitula 50–58 mm long, in terminal globose synflorescences 8–15 cm in diameter, with a few reflexed bracts; stalk of synflorescence 4–22 cm long; phyllaries oblanceolate, 17–48 mm long, attenuate and ending in a cluster of setae, the outermost pubescent. Corolla heavily fragrant, white or cream, tube 7–20 mm long, glandular and sometimes pilose, lobes 7–20 mm long, anthers pale brown, style white. Achenes columnar, 11–17 mm long, sparsely to densely pilose with ascending hairs; pappus of laciniate scales 1–5 mm long. Fig. 9.
Range
DISTR. U 2; T 1, 4, 7
Altitude range
1100–2300 m
Distribution
TANZANIA Bukoba District Karagwe, Oct. 1931, Haarer 2254!TANZANIA Ufipa District Sumbawanga– Chala road, Feb. 1990, Congdon 238!TANZANIA Mbeya District Ijombe, Apr. 1983, Macha 256!UGANDA Kigezi District Nyakagyeme [Nyakagene], June 1946, Purseglove 2087!UGANDA Bunyoro District Bunyoro, Nov. 1915, Snowden 291!
Distribution (external)
; Nigeria
Cameroon
Ethiopia
Congo (Kinshasa)
Rwanda
Sudan
